2003 Sunshine West Showcase
McCabe is a right-hander with a good sized body and easy working arm. At 6 foot 5 and 220 pounds we were hoping for slightly more velocity but he pitched well and mixed 3 good pitches for strikes. His fastball was 80-83 and lacked life but was never down the middle of the plate. His curve worked well at 68-69 mph consistently and he also threw a splitty at 74 mph that he used ahead in the count successfully. His command of 3 pitches was not hard to believe since his release point was about identical on every pitch. He has good mechanics and an overall good looking package, only lacking the arm speed that will get his velocity up in the high 80's. We will not be surprised when he throws that hard in the near future. Good student.
